What Are Divorce Services?
Divorce services encompass a range of professional assistance designed to guide individuals through the dissolution of marriage. These services may include legal representation, mediation, financial planning, and emotional support. Their primary goal is to ensure that clients understand their rights, obligations, and options, while minimizing conflict and promoting fair outcomes.
The rise of divorce services has been fueled by the increasing complexity of family law, financial arrangements, and child custody issues. While some individuals attempt to navigate divorce independently, professional assistance can reduce errors, expedite processes, and provide peace of mind.
Types of Divorce Services
Divorce services can be broadly categorized into legal, financial, and emotional support services. Each plays a critical role in helping clients manage different aspects of divorce.
1. Legal Divorce Services
Legal divorce services form the backbone of professional support during a divorce. Attorneys specializing in family law help clients understand their legal rights and represent them in negotiations or court proceedings. Common legal divorce services include:
-
Filing Divorce Petitions: Attorneys guide clients in drafting and submitting legal documents required to initiate divorce.
-
Legal Representation: Lawyers advocate on behalf of clients during court proceedings or settlement negotiations.
-
Child Custody and Support: Legal experts help determine custody arrangements and calculate child support, ensuring compliance with local laws.
-
Division of Assets: Attorneys assist in dividing marital property fairly, taking into account assets, debts, and financial contributions.
By leveraging professional legal knowledge, clients can avoid pitfalls and ensure their interests are adequately protected.
2. Mediation Services
Mediation is a voluntary process in which a neutral third party assists couples in reaching mutually acceptable agreements. Divorce mediators specialize in conflict resolution and can be invaluable for couples seeking an amicable separation. Benefits of mediation include:
-
Cost-Effectiveness: Mediation often costs less than prolonged court battles.
-
Time-Saving: Agreements can be reached more quickly compared to litigation.
-
Preservation of Relationships: Mediation encourages cooperation and communication, which is especially important when children are involved.
Mediators focus on resolving disputes regarding property, finances, and parenting without escalating conflicts, making the divorce process smoother and less adversarial.
3. Financial Divorce Services
Financial considerations are often the most complicated aspect of divorce. Financial divorce services help individuals navigate issues like asset division, tax implications, and post-divorce planning. Key services include:
-
Dividing Assets and Liabilities: Financial experts evaluate property, investments, and debts to ensure equitable distribution.
-
Spousal Support Planning: Advisors calculate appropriate alimony or spousal support based on income, lifestyle, and legal requirements.
-
Tax Planning: Financial planners assist clients in understanding potential tax liabilities resulting from property transfers, alimony, or other financial arrangements.
-
Retirement and Estate Planning: Post-divorce financial planning ensures long-term security and stability.
Engaging professionals in this area can prevent costly mistakes and provide clarity on future financial obligations.
4. Emotional and Therapeutic Support
Divorce is not just a legal or financial process; it is an emotional journey. Many divorce services include counseling and therapy to support individuals during this challenging time. Options include:
-
Individual Therapy: Helps individuals process grief, anger, and anxiety related to divorce.
-
Family Therapy: Supports children and families in adjusting to the new family dynamics.
-
Support Groups: Provides a safe environment for sharing experiences and gaining practical advice from others who have gone through divorce.
Emotional support can significantly reduce stress and improve decision-making during the divorce process.
